> > > >> From: Etienne Cordonnier <ecordonnier@snap.com>
> > > >>
> > > >> The function do_symlink_kernsrc is not reentrant in the case where S
> > is
> > > >> defined
> > > >> to a non-default value. This causes build-failures e.g. when building
> > > >> linux-yocto, then updating
> > > >> poky to a commit which modifies kernel.bbclass, and then building
> > > >> linux-yocto again.
> > > >>

> > > >> Tested with a recipe "my-custom-linux" which unpacks sources to a
> > custom
> > > >> ${S} directory
> > > >> and ran symlink_kernsrc several times:
> > > >> $ bitbake -f -c symlink_kernsrc my-custom-linux
> > > >>
> > > >> Signed-off-by: Etienne Cordonnier <ecordonnier@snap.com>
> > > >> ---
> > > >> meta/classes-recipe/kernel.bbclass | 8 +++++++-
> > > >> 1 file changed, 7 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)
> > > >>
> > > >> diff --git a/meta/classes-recipe/kernel.bbclass
> > > >> b/meta/classes-recipe/kernel.bbclass
> > > >> index 9ff37f5c38..45b63f1fa1 100644
> > > >> --- a/meta/classes-recipe/kernel.bbclass
> > > >> +++ b/meta/classes-recipe/kernel.bbclass
> > > >> @@ -189,11 +189,17 @@ python do_symlink_kernsrc () {
> > > >> # drop trailing slash, so that os.symlink(kernsrc, s)
> > > >> doesn't use s as
> > > >> # directory name and fail
> > > >> s = s[:-1]
> > > >> - if d.getVar("EXTERNALSRC"):
> > > >> + if d.getVar("EXTERNALSRC") and not os.path.islink(s):
> > > >> # With EXTERNALSRC S will not be wiped so we can symlink
> > to
> > > >> it
> > > >> os.symlink(s, kernsrc)
> > > >> else:
> > > >> import shutil
> > > >> + # perform idempotent/reentrant copy
> > > >> + s_copy = s + ".orig"
> > > >> + if not os.path.isdir(s_copy):
> > > >> + shutil.copytree(s, s_copy,
> > ignore_dangling_symlinks=True)
> > > >> + bb.utils.remove(s, recurse=True)
> > > >> + shutil.copytree(s_copy, s, ignore_dangling_symlinks=True)
> > > >> shutil.move(s, kernsrc)
> > > >> os.symlink(kernsrc, s)
> > > >> }
